Piraeus Bank Romania increases interest rates on lei deposits
For the Gold deposit account, which requires a minimum RON 4,000, the bank plans to raise interest by 0.50-1 percent. For lei savings products, Piraeus Bank Romania has also added deposits with 9 and 12-month maturity.

Piraeus increased interest by half a percentage point for its 1-month Gold account, to 7.75 from 7.25 percent, and for 3-month maturity by 0.9 percentage points, to an annual 8.25 from 7.35 percent. Annual interest for the 6-month Gold account was raised by one percentage point, to 8.50 percent. The new 9 and 12-month Gold deposits have annual interest of 8.25 and 8.00 percent, respectively. In addition to the Gold account, the bank’s savings portfolio also includes a “Secure Money” account, with fixed interest available to the client on a monthly basis or at maturity, a “Your Future” account, which allows for a periodic increase in savings without the need to set up a new deposit account, and an “Ideal” savings account, which makes savings available to clients on demand, without accumulated interest being cancelled prior to that time.

The bank offers banking services targeting individuals, small and medium-sized enterprises (SME), the capital market, investment banking and leasing. By December 2007, Piraeus Bank Romania had a 4.6 percent lending market share, up two percentage points year-on-year. Its assets by the end of September 2007 amounted to some €2.2 billion, while profit in the first nine months of 2007 rose to some €15 million.
